自从我踏入iOS开发的领域,苹果签名就成为了我职业生涯中不可或缺的一部分。在这个充满挑战和机遇的世界里,我逐渐摸索出了一套稳定好用的付费企业签名套餐,下面就来分享我的心得体会。
P12证书使用,这是我签名的第一步。每次拿到新的证书,我都会小心翼翼地导入到Xcode中,生怕一个不小心就弄丢了。这个过程虽然繁琐,但却是保证签名稳定的前提。
不同渠道的真实价格,这是我在选择付费企业签名套餐时最关心的问题。市面上有很多报价低廉的选项,但往往伴随着不稳定的风险。我选择了一家口碑良好的服务商,虽然价格稍高,但服务质量和稳定性都让我放心。
设备签名原理,这是我对苹果签名深入理解的关键。简单来说,设备签名就是通过P12证书对IPA包进行加密,使得应用能够在没有AppStore的情况下运行。这个过程中,UDID绑定起到了至关重要的作用。
UDID绑定,这是我遇到过最多问题的环节。有时候,设备UDID丢失或者更换后,签名就会失效。这时候,我不得不重新绑定UDID,有时候还要重新下载整个应用。这个过程让我深刻体会到了UDID绑定的痛苦。
证书分发机制,这是保障签名稳定的关键。服务商通常会提供证书分发工具,让我能够方便地将证书分发给团队成员。这个机制大大提高了团队的开发效率,也让签名更加稳定。
在签名的过程中,我遇到了不少掉签、补签的问题。有一次,一个应用因为证书过期而掉签,我赶紧联系了服务商,他们迅速帮我解决了问题。还有一次,一个应用因为代码更改而补签失败,我通过重新打包和签名,最终恢复了应用。
H5封装,这是我用来解决应用兼容性问题的一种方法。有时候,应用在部分设备上运行不稳定,我就会将应用封装成H5页面,这样用户就可以在网页上访问应用了。
IPA签名,这是我对应用进行签名的主要方式。每次签名前,我都会仔细检查应用的版本号、bundle identifier等信息,确保签名正确无误。
AppStore上架,这是我开发应用的最终目标。通过付费企业签名套餐,我能够轻松地将应用上传到AppStore,让更多的用户使用我的产品。
TF签名,这是我在测试过程中使用的一种签名方式。TF签名可以让我在不影响正式签名的情况下,对应用进行测试和调试。
在这个充满挑战的iOS开发世界里,付费企业签名套餐成为了我稳定的保障。虽然过程中遇到了不少问题,但我始终坚持着,不断学习和改进。现在,我已经能够熟练地运用这些技巧,为用户提供稳定、高效的应用。
回首这段历程,我感慨万分。正是因为有了这些经验,我才能在这个领域不断前行。我相信,只要我们坚持不懈,就一定能够克服一切困难,实现自己的梦想。